austro-
Save This Word!
a combining form meaning “south,” used in the formation of compound words: Austronesia.

British Dictionary definitions for austro- (1 of 2)
Austro-1
/ (ˈɒstrəʊ-) /
combining form
southernAustro-Asiatic
Word Origin for Austro-
from Latin auster the south wind
